Home is a Place Where I Feel

What does home mean to me? Let me think for a second. Home is a safe place where I feel loved and welcomed. I feel at home when my family sits on the sofa together and watches movies with tasty buttery popcorn. The scent of popcorn wafts from the well used kitchen. Home is when me and my sister read fantasy novels in our warm living room while eating salty chips. Home is where me and my family eat our dinner. It's fun to chat with them. I feel like home can be anyplace to me. I feel at home when I‘m outside playing with my friends in the cold wintery white snow. When I’m playing with my friends I don't feel the cold at all. Home is where I learn new things at school. Sitting at my desk wondering what amazing activities we're going to do next. Home is in my grandparents house where I eat yummy chocolates and have sweet dreams under the starry night. Home is where my fish calm me down at the end of a tiring long day Home makes me feel loved, warm, safe, happy, and that I belong. What does home mean to you?
